What does CareCheck look for?
Signs of mental strain in everyday messages: worry, low mood, loneliness, sleep trouble, panic, self-blame, giving-up language, money and health pressure, and the quiet signs such as going silent or asking for you and not being answered.
Is this a diagnosis?
No. It is a careful reading of written words, the way a thoughtful friend would read them. It does not replace a doctor, counsellor, or crisis line. If you think someone is in danger, reach out today.
Whose chats can I use?
Only chats you are part of and have a right to use, to care for family and friends. Not for monitoring a partner, an employee, or anyone who would object.
Which apps and languages?
WhatsApp, Telegram, LINE, KakaoTalk, Viber, Messenger and Instagram export directly; iMessage, WeChat and Signal work with a short copy step. Step-by-step for each app. English, Hindi, Bengali, Urdu and romanised mixes on device; the deep read handles most languages.
What leaves my phone?
Nothing for the on-device pass. The optional deep read is performed by a third-party AI service: a condensed extract goes to our server at vision-suite.ai and on to Anthropic PBC, whose Claude API does the reading, does not train on it and does not keep it afterwards. CareCheck asks your permission before sending, every time, and you can decline and keep the reading on your phone. No accounts, no copies.

Where your chat is read, and who reads it
The first reading happens entirely on this device. Nothing is sent anywhere, and no account is needed.
CareCheck also offers an optional deep read, which is performed by a third-party AI service. If you choose it, CareCheck sends a condensed extract of the chat — message counts and dates, up to about 1,000 of the other person’s messages word for word with their dates, a few of your own replies for context, and the two names as they appear in the chat. The exported file, media, phone numbers, contacts and your location are never sent.
That extract is received by Fugumobile (our relay server at vision-suite.ai, which keeps no copy) and processed by Anthropic PBC using the Claude API. Anthropic does not train on it and does not keep it after the reading is returned.
CareCheck will ask your permission on screen before anything is sent, every time, and you can say no and keep the reading on your phone. Full detail is in the privacy policy.
